diff options
author | erihel <erihel@gmail.com> | 2012-08-31 22:28:07 +0200 |
---|---|---|
committer | erihel <erihel@gmail.com> | 2012-08-31 22:28:07 +0200 |
commit | 6ba0f42f22a170625f15879e01b4653a4ac153a1 (patch) | |
tree | 129478ed8c5e4fd167c7c77c8ce00b88c5a4f83b /src/ui/gauge.h | |
parent | 5408fe92527a4df01e4d66a2cdfdbbbea5738afc (diff) | |
download | colobot-6ba0f42f22a170625f15879e01b4653a4ac153a1.tar.gz colobot-6ba0f42f22a170625f15879e01b4653a4ac153a1.tar.bz2 colobot-6ba0f42f22a170625f15879e01b4653a4ac153a1.zip |
latest changes; few more classes should compile now
Diffstat (limited to 'src/ui/gauge.h')
-rw-r--r-- | src/ui/gauge.h | 33 |
1 files changed, 17 insertions, 16 deletions
diff --git a/src/ui/gauge.h b/src/ui/gauge.h index b745834..8b7ef66 100644 --- a/src/ui/gauge.h +++ b/src/ui/gauge.h @@ -19,35 +19,36 @@ #pragma once +#include <graphics/engine/engine.h> -#include "ui/control.h" +#include <common/event.h> +#include <common/misc.h> + +#include <ui/control.h> -namespace Gfx{ -class CEngine; -}; namespace Ui { class CGauge : public CControl { -public: -// CGauge(CInstanceManager* iMan); - CGauge(); - virtual ~CGauge(); + public: + // CGauge(CInstanceManager* iMan); + CGauge(); + virtual ~CGauge(); - bool Create(Math::Point pos, Math::Point dim, int icon, EventType eventType); + bool Create(Math::Point pos, Math::Point dim, int icon, EventType eventType); - bool EventProcess(const Event &event); + bool EventProcess(const Event &event); - void Draw(); + void Draw(); - void SetLevel(float level); - float GetLevel(); + void SetLevel(float level); + float GetLevel(); -protected: + protected: -protected: - float m_level; + protected: + float m_level; }; |